The fetal echocardiogram is a targeted ultrasound that is used to examine the fetal heart in more detail than a standard anatomy ultrasound. This test is typically performed after the 18th week of gestation by a highly trained sonographer and is do in addition to a routine anatomy ultrasound. This test can be utilized to determine the structure and the function of the fetal heart and gives a better imaging of any inconclusive or insufficient readings on a standard test.
